Merseyside Police Renew Appeal in 2007 Disappearance of Ray Shearwood

Detectives mark the 18th anniversary with a fresh appeal for information in the suspected murder.

Overview

  • CCTV last captured the 36-year-old at about 4:45pm on August 19, 2007, parking a green Ford Mondeo at the Alt Park pub in Maghull before walking toward a Volkswagen Golf.
  • The Serious Crime Review Unit says the case is treated as a murder inquiry, with no body recovered, no contact from Shearwood, and his mobile phone unused since that day.
  • One line of inquiry points to an unpaid drug debt linked to a gang described as notorious and involved in international drug crime.
  • Shearwood, a former boxer and father-of-three, had prior convictions for drug supply, money laundering and tax evasion, and was released from prison in November 2006.
